##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
- **2020-06-11** Effective date 6/11/2020.
- **2020-06-11** Signed by the Governor. Becomes Act No. 230. `executive-signature`
- **2020-06-01** Sent to the Governor by the Secretary of the Senate on 6/2/2020. `executive-receipt`
- **2020-06-01** Signed by the Speaker of the House.
- **2020-06-01** Enrolled. Signed by the President of the Senate.
- **2020-05-31** Amendments proposed by the House read and concurred in by a vote of 34 yeas and 0 nays.
- **2020-05-29** Received from the House with amendments.
- **2020-05-29** Read third time by title, amended, roll called on final passage, yeas 101, nays 0. Finally passed, ordered to the Senate. `passage`
- **2020-05-29** Called from the calendar.
- **2020-05-28** Read by title, amended, returned to the calendar.
- **2020-05-28** Called from the calendar.
- **2020-05-28** Read by title, returned to the calendar.
- **2020-05-22** Scheduled for floor debate on 05/28/20.
- **2020-05-21** Read by title, amended, passed to 3rd reading.
- **2020-05-20** Reported without Legislative Bureau amendments.
- **2020-05-20** Reported with amendments (12-0). Referred to the Legislative Bureau.
- **2020-05-18** Read by title, under the rules, referred to the Committee on Insurance. `referral-committee`
- **2020-05-15** Received in the House from the Senate, read by title, lies over under the rules.
- **2020-05-14** Senate floor amendments read and adopted. Read by title and passed by a vote of 34 yeas and 0 nays; ordered reengrossed and sent to the House. Motion to reconsider tabled. `passage`
- **2020-05-07** Reported with amendments. Rules suspended. Read by title; Committee amendments read and adopted. Ordered engrossed and passed to third reading and final passage.
- **2020-05-04** Read second time by title and referred to the Committee on Insurance. `referral-committee`
- **2020-03-16** Rules suspended. Introduced in the Senate. Read by title and placed on the Calendar for a second reading.
